AI Architecture

ChatGPT uses a traditional transformer framework. This means it uses all of its resources to respond to user prompts. It is trained more, as it is older than DeepSeek, and therefore has access to more data while responding.

DeepSeek, on the other hand, is built on a Mixture of Experts (MoE) framework. This means it refers the user prompt to a specialized expert model to respond to that specific request.

The reason behind DeepSeek’s faster response times is its better resource allocation, which gives it an edge over ChatGPT in terms of speed.

In this area of MoE vs Transformer in LLMs, the competition between DeepSeek vs ChatGPT reflects differences in model efficiency and task handling.

Accuracy, Reasoning, and Knowledge Base

When it comes to accuracy, both ChatGPT and DeepSeek perform well. But DeepSeek shows a higher accuracy rate in solving complex mathematical problems. This is because its MoE model allocates resources more effectively to each task.

In terms of reasoning, both tools support multi-step logical thinking. However, DeepSeek’s approach, which shows what it is thinking, makes it more engaging for many users.

For the knowledge base, ChatGPT takes the lead. It has been trained over a longer period and on much more data. Its training cost was around $500 million, which is 10x more than DeepSeek.

Although DeepSeek lags slightly in raw knowledge coverage, it still performs impressively even with fewer resources. That’s a major achievement in the current AI space.

Privacy, Security & Ethical Concerns

Your privacy and security are highly prioritized in ChatGPT. Since it is proprietary and not owned by any government, it has well-defined privacy boundaries. It now also provides a temporary chat feature that avoids saving your history — a key feature for handling sensitive data.

In contrast, DeepSeek includes privacy features, but as it is open-source and developed in China, there may be concerns related to data sharing with the Chinese government.

ChatGPT can assist you even without signing up. To attach files, you will be required to sign up or log in. DeepSeek doesn’t let you interact with it until you sign up or log in.

ChatGPT avoids biased responses, nudity, or explicit content, whereas DeepSeek can be bypassed more easily by using rephrased inputs. This raises concerns in ethical use cases.

Coding & Debugging

While coding, there are many errors that come. And we can refer to these tools to debug.

The comparison of DeepSeek vs ChatGPT is about such a case where we gave a function to both.

The prompt was:
“Here is a Python function that reverses strings incorrectly—they gave an IndexError. Fix it.
def reverse_string(s):
return s[-1] + s[:-1]”

DeepSeek vs. ChatGPT Coding and Debugging Task Comparison

We have analyzed both responses, and here’s what we got:

  • DeepSeek took 66 seconds while reasoning.
  • ChatGPT responded in 5 seconds at most.
  • DeepSeek explained the whole concept and tried to solve this by using different examples.
  • ChatGPT explained the problem, the reason behind it, gave the code, and then explained simple and easy wording.
  • DeepSeek also did it, but it gave such a result, so if I read and memorize the reasoning context, then, in the future, I would be able to debug suchan error by myself.

Here, we don’t tell you the winner.
You will decide which to choose, as you may or may not want or like to understand the concept and solve it next time.

Cost Comparison

DeepSeek is completely free to use.
You are not bound to any limits.

But as it is explained above, it doesn’t support the multimodal capability yet.
So then you’ll need to use ChatGPT.

ChatGPT puts some restrictions on you.
It has mainly three plans: Free, Plus ($20/month), and Pro ($200/month).

Plus and Pro Plans of ChatGPT

The free plan lets you interact with its advanced version, ChatGPT-4o, for a limited time, and then it switches to older versions.

There is a limit on uploading files, analyzing and making Word documents, and messages.

But you can use the Plus or Pro plan according to your needs to avoid such cases.

If cost-effectiveness is your top priority, you can still use ChatGPT’s free plan.
